Statement I : Nitrogen forms oxides with +1 to +5 oxidation states due to the formation of $\mathrm{p} \pi-\mathrm{p} \pi$ bond with oxygen.
Statement II : Nitrogen does not form halides with +5 oxidation state due to the absence of d-orbital in it.
In the light of given statements, choose the correct answer from the options given below.
- Statement I is true but Statement II is false
- Both Statement I and Statement II are false
- Statement I is false but Statement II is true
- Both Statement I and Statement II are true
Solution

Nitrogen cannot form halide in +5 oxidation state because it does not contain d-orbital.
e.g. $\mathrm{NX}_5$ does not exist
$\mathrm{X}=\text { halide }$
